I was thinking of buying a secondhand PC for a web server.  I hear the going rate is about $100.  I don't need much however I thought I would take a look at a minimal system at Dell.

I found this http://configure.us.dell.com/dellstore/config.aspx?oc=ddcwca11&c=us&l=en&s=dhs&cs=19&model_id=inspiron-560s  

Would easily meet my needs and the price is right at $279+shipping & Tax.

So I contacted Dell and asked about a refund for the OS since I will be running Linux.  I was told they give no refund even if I do not agree with the TOS for the OS.

I know I have heard of others getting a refund however they had to spend a day to get the refund.  Legally I think I am do a refund, however I'm not willing to work the whole day to do so.

Any advice / comments?
